Mathematical modelling of a single tethered aerostat using longitudinal stability derivatives

Anoop Sasidharan,
Ratna Kishore Velamati,
Akram Mohammad
et al.

Abstract: Lighter-than-air (LTA) aerial vehicles such as airships and aerostats can be found in various strategic and commercial applications, primarily due to their capability to hover and stealth. The mathematical model of these vehicles helps in understanding their complex dynamics and designing and developing proper stabilisation systems for them. Stability derivatives have been used for developing mathematical models for heavier-than-air aerial vehicles since their introduction. This paper presents a methodology to… Show more
